Well stopped into MWFI today, if i order the part online and get it shipped there, install is about $600. So total is installed price is about $1600. Expensive labor cost so im looking into other people i have connections with to see how much they will charge to install.

And get this, if i dont buy it on there site and have it shipped to there store, they want $2100 installed price for it, if i just walk in there and buy it there. So buy on there own site and then show up at there shop is like $500 cheaper. Crazy.....

ITS ALIVE!!!!!! Thanks to everyone for the help, and the person who wrote this
https://www.dieseltruckresource.com/...n&onlynewfaq=1

I used that to do the entire install. Seems to run better then when i bought it 1400 miles ago. And the pump that came off had NO Paint. Looks to have been the original, and with 264k miles!!

I also installed the low pressure kit from MWFI. The red light goes on if the feed/lift pump go out you know.
